The cost of dental veneers including additional fees

  • Composite veneers: From £500 per tooth
  • Porcelain veneers: From £1,100 per tooth
  • Lumineers: £900 per tooth.
  • Ultrathin: £1,100 per tooth.

What affects the cost?

  • The type of material used – Porcelain (Lumineers or Ultrathin) is more expensive than composite resin veneers.
  • The number of veneers required (priced per tooth), so the more you have, the higher the cost.
  • Your dental health – e.g. if you require additional treatment for issues like tooth decay before veneers can be fitted.
